What are the main prostate cancer care pathways?

Prostate cancer care pathways typically involve several stages, beginning with diagnosis and progressing through treatment and follow-up care. The initial pathway often includes screening tests, such as prostate-specific antigen (PSA) blood tests and digital rectal exams. If cancer is suspected, further diagnostic procedures like biopsies may be conducted. Once diagnosed, patients and their medical teams discuss treatment options, which can range from active surveillance for low-risk cancers to more intensive interventions for aggressive forms of the disease.

How does active surveillance differ from immediate treatment?

Active surveillance is an approach used for low-risk, slow-growing prostate cancers. This method involves closely monitoring the cancer through regular PSA tests, digital rectal exams, and periodic biopsies, without immediately pursuing active treatment. The goal is to avoid or delay unnecessary treatment and its potential side effects. In contrast, immediate treatment options like surgery or radiation therapy are typically recommended for more aggressive cancers or when the disease shows signs of progression.

What are the primary surgical and radiation-based treatment options?

Surgical options for prostate cancer primarily involve radical prostatectomy, where the entire prostate gland and some surrounding tissue are removed. This can be performed through traditional open surgery or minimally invasive techniques like laparoscopic or robotic-assisted surgery. Radiation therapy, on the other hand, uses high-energy rays to kill cancer cells. It can be delivered externally (external beam radiation therapy) or internally (brachytherapy, where radioactive seeds are implanted in the prostate).

Which factors influence prostate cancer treatment decisions?

Several factors play a crucial role in determining the most appropriate treatment approach for prostate cancer. These include:

  1. Cancer stage and grade: The extent of cancer spread and its aggressiveness.
  2. Patient’s age and overall health: Younger, healthier patients may be candidates for more aggressive treatments.
  3. PSA levels: Higher levels may indicate more advanced cancer.
  4. Patient preferences: Some may prioritize quality of life over aggressive treatment.
  5. Potential side effects: Different treatments carry varying risks of urinary incontinence, erectile dysfunction, and other complications.

What are some emerging treatments and clinical trials for prostate cancer?

Prostate cancer research continues to advance, offering new hope for patients. Emerging treatments include targeted therapies that attack specific cancer cell features, immunotherapies that boost the body’s natural defenses, and precision medicine approaches that tailor treatment based on genetic profiles. Cryotherapy, which freezes cancer cells, and high-intensity focused ultrasound (HIFU) are also being explored as less invasive alternatives to traditional surgery or radiation.

How is post-treatment monitoring and follow-up care managed?


Post-treatment monitoring is crucial for detecting recurrence and managing side effects. This typically involves regular PSA tests, with the frequency depending on the type of treatment received and the patient’s risk level. Digital rectal exams may also be performed periodically. For patients who underwent radiation therapy, follow-up may include occasional imaging tests to check for signs of cancer recurrence.

Long-term follow-up care often addresses potential side effects of treatment, such as urinary or sexual function issues. This may involve consultations with urologists, sexual health specialists, or pelvic floor physical therapists. Additionally, patients are monitored for potential secondary cancers that can develop as a result of radiation therapy.

Follow-Up Care Component Frequency Purpose
PSA Test Every 3-6 months for 5 years, then annually Monitor for cancer recurrence
Digital Rectal Exam Annually Check for local recurrence
Imaging Tests As needed Evaluate suspicious symptoms or rising PSA
Quality of Life Assessment Regularly Address treatment-related side effects

Note: Follow-up care schedules may vary based on individual circumstances and treatment history. Consult with your healthcare provider for personalized recommendations.
